Jak przekonwertować znak na liczbę całkowitą w Pythonie i odwrotnie?

310

Chcę uzyskać, biorąc pod uwagę postać, jej ASCIIwartość.

Na przykład dla postaci achcę ją zdobyć 97i odwrotnie.

Manuel Aráoz
źródło

Odpowiedzi:

37
>>> ord('a')
97
>>> chr(97)
'a'
dwc
źródło
Opublikowałeś tę odpowiedź 1 minutę przed tym drugim facetem, który wciąż przegapił ponad 500 głosów poparcia ...
oriont
14

ord and chr

rmmh
źródło
71
Moją ulubioną częścią tej odpowiedzi jest to, że przypadkowo napisali prawidłową linię Pythona.
ArtOfWarfare
1
print ((ord and chr)(0O041))
AndyB